Описание: Karl King wrote “The Melody Shop” in 1910 while working with the Robinson Famous Shows circus. The march grew into one of his most well known works, shaped by his early years as a young performer and composer in the circus world. King later founded the K. L. King Music House and led the Grand Army Band in Canton, Ohio. His writing reflects fast pacing, crisp lines, and the signature low brass trio that continues to challenge players.
